Match Analysis

Jong Ajax host Roda at Sportcomplex De Toekomst in Eerste Divisie, Regular Season - 7. Kick-off is scheduled for Friday 18 September 2026 at 18:00 UTC.

Recent Form

Across all Eerste Divisie games this season, Jong Ajax have gone 2W 1D 7L from 10 outings — a 0.70 PPG return. Last five: L L L W D. Offensively they are averaging 1.60 goals per game, with 2.80 conceded. However, 2.80 goals conceded per game is a concern — opposing attacks have exploited them regularly. 1 clean sheet from 10 outings provides some defensive foundation. Both teams have scored in 80% of their matches — an extremely high rate that makes BTTS Yes a well-supported standalone angle from their form alone. Jong Ajax have played only a handful of Eerste Divisie games so far this season, so this record also draws on matches from last season.

Jong Ajax at Sportcomplex De Toekomst this season: 4W 1D 5L from 10 home games — 1.30 PPG on home soil. They are averaging 2.10 goals per home game — a prolific scoring rate in front of their own fans. Both teams have scored in 80% of their home games — an outstanding BTTS rate that is a key data point for this fixture. Their home PPG of 1.30 is noticeably stronger than their overall 0.70 — Jong Ajax are significantly better at Sportcomplex De Toekomst than their overall form suggests.

Looking at all fixtures this season, Roda stand at 3W 4D 3L from 10 Eerste Divisie matches — 1.30 PPG. Last five: D L W W D. Their scoring rate of 1.20 per game is modest, conceding 1.20 — not a side to back heavily on the Over 2.5 from their form alone. 1 clean sheet from 10 outings suggests some defensive organisation. Both teams have scored in 60% of their games — a noteworthy BTTS rate that supports the Yes market. Roda have played only a handful of Eerste Divisie games so far this season, so this record also draws on matches from last season.

On the road, Roda have gone 5W 3D 2L from 10 away fixtures this term (1.80 PPG). Away from home they average 1.50 goals scored and 1.00 conceded per game. BTTS has landed in 60% of their away games — meaningful support for the Yes angle in this specific context. Their away PPG of 1.80 exceeds their overall 1.30 — they actually perform better on the road than their aggregate form implies.

Form points away from home here. Roda's 1.30 PPG return is 0.60 points per game ahead of Jong Ajax's 0.70 — the visitors are the form-based selection, and Double Chance is an alternative worth pricing if the outright looks tight.

The BTTS market is worth targeting here. Jong Ajax register both teams scoring in 80% of relevant matches, Roda in 60% (using home/away splits) — both sides above the 60% threshold gives BTTS Yes firm statistical grounding.

Head to Head

There is little to separate the sides historically. From 10 previous meetings, Jong Ajax have won 2, Roda 4, with 4 draws — a balanced ledger that offers no obvious directional steer on its own.

Goals have been a feature of this fixture. The last 10 meetings have averaged 3.3 per game — a rate that gives the Over 2.5 market a solid historical foundation. The most recent clash, on 19 Jan 2026, ended 2–2 with a draw.

With the win record balanced, the strongest H2H-derived signal is in the goals market. At 3.3 goals per game historically, Over 2.5 is the cleaner angle to extract from the head-to-head data.

Poisson Model

The Poisson distribution model projects Jong Ajax 1.57 xG and Roda 2.10 xG. These expected goals figures are the primary input: they feed a goal-probability matrix across all scoreline combinations to derive the result and market probabilities below. Underlying strength ratings: Jong Ajax attack 1.184 / defence 1.463 | Roda attack 0.844 / defence 0.750. League average goals — home 1.770 / away 1.698. Roda's defence strength of 0.750 is below average — they are conceding at a rate that inflates the home xG figure. Data: 43 Jong Ajax games / 42 Roda games used (CurrentSeason).

Result probabilities: Jong Ajax 29% | Draw 21% | Roda 50%. Fair-value odds: Jong Ajax 3.45 | Draw 4.76 | Roda 2.00. Roda hold a narrow Poisson edge at 50% — the draw (21%) is close enough to merit draw-inclusive market consideration.

Goals markets: Over 2.5 probability 71% | BTTS probability 70% | Total xG 3.67. Over 2.5 is the model's clear signal at 71% — a total xG of 3.67 means the expected score alone exceeds the 2.5 threshold, making the Over not just likely but structurally supported by both sides' attack/defence profiles. BTTS Yes at 70% reflects that both xG figures (1.57 / 2.10) are above the threshold where scoring blanks become the primary outcome — both sides are projected to find the net.
